I noticed a small inconsistency on my Thinkpad X230 which has a hardware connection switch to disable my Wi-Fi and my Bluetooth connections.
Once switched, the Bluetooth indicator icon disappears but the Wi-Fi one remains visible.
This is also demonstrated in this screencast:
https:/
What is the logic behind this behaviour? Why does the Bluetooth one disappear but the Wi-Fi one not?
